Clostridium perfringens presents a significant public health hazard to consumers of foods which have undergone improper processing or have been improperly handled at some point before consumption. Factors involved in outbreaks of C. perfringens foodborne illness include contamination of food with either spores or vegetative cells of enterotoxigenic strains of C. perfringens, suitable growth temperature. pH, media, oxidation reduction potential, and adequate incubation time. With proper handling of food items, the risk of C. perfringens foodborne illness outbreaks can be eliminated.


Chicken meat are being widely consumed as they contain high protein and a healthier unsaturated fat type. Chicken burger represent a consumer palatable chicken product. Both chicken and its products are liable to different types of contamination during their preparation and processing. Contamination by S. aureus and its enterotoxins poses a major public health hazard to chicken meat consumes. During this study 100 different samples of chicken fillet, deboned thigh, wing, mechanically deboned meat (MDM) and chicken burger (20 each) was collected from market and investigated for their S. aureus count and ability of the isolated strains to produce enterotoxins using conventional plating and isolation technique as well as using SET-RPLA toxin detection kit. Results revealed that mean values of S. aureus count in all samples exceeded the permissible limits and hence being unacceptable. MDM isolated exhibited staphylococcal enterotoxins (SEs) production of three different types SEA, SEC and SED. Meanwhile chicken burger S. aureus isolates produced only SEA and SEC enterotoxins. While isolated S. aureus from chicken fillet and deboned thigh didn’t exhibit any enterotoxin production activity. It’s recommended to follow the hygienic practices during different processing stages to avoid the risk of S. aureus and its enterotoxins.

Water, sanitation and hygiene (WASH) factors are responsible for 11.4% of deaths in Zambia, making WASH a key public health concern. Despite annual waterborne disease outbreaks in the nation’s peri-urban (slum) settlements being linked to poor WASH, few studies have proactively analysed and conceptualised peri-urban WASH and its maintaining factors. Our study aimed to (a) establish residents’ definition of peri-urban WASH and their WASH priorities; and (b) use ecological theory to analyse the peri-urban WASH ecosystem, highlighting maintaining factors. Our study incorporated 16 young people (aged 17–24) residing in peri-urban Lusaka, Zambia in a photovoice exercise. Participants took photographs answering the framing question, ‘What is WASH in your community?’ Then, through contextualisation and basic codifying, participants told the stories of their photographs and made posters to summarise problems and WASH priorities. Participant contextualisation and codifying further underwent theoretical thematic analysis to pinpoint causal factors alongside key players, dissecting the peri-urban WASH ecosystem via the five-tier ecological theory ranging from intrapersonal to public policy levels. Via ecological theory, peri-urban WASH was defined as: (a) poor practice (intrapersonal, interpersonal); (b) a health hazard (community norm); (c) substandard and unregulated (public policy, organisational); and (d) offering hope for change (intrapersonal, interpersonal). Linked to these themes, participant findings revealed a community level gap, with public policy level standards, regulations and implementation having minimal impact on overall peri-urban WASH and public health due to shallow community engagement and poor acknowledgement of the WASH realities of high-density locations. Rather than a top-down approach, participants recommended increased government–resident collaboration, offering residents more ownership and empowerment for intervention, implementation and defending of preferred peri-urban WASH standards.

Staphylococcus aureus, Clostridium perfringens. Salmonella choleraesuis, and Salmonella typhimurium were inoculated (108 cells or spores) into two slow cookers containing green bean casserole, baked navy beans, chicken cacciatore, barbecued ribs or pork pot roast, and their fate determined after cooking. Heating patterns also were determined at three positions inside the two cookers. None of the foods cooked in either of the slow cookers contained detectable levels of S. aureus or salmonellae. The similarity between C. perfringens vegetative and spore counts indicate that only spores were present in the cooked foods. Except for the green bean casserole cooked using a low temperature setting, cooking resulted in a 0.44–1.67 and 0.36–1.54 log count reduction, respectively, of vegetative cells and spores of C. perfringens. Counts of vegetative cells and spores after cooking the green bean casserole were approximately .18 and .30 log counts higher than the uncooked counts. The mean times for the coldest areas in Cooker A to reach 50 C were 2.57 and 0.97 h, respectively, for the low (80 watts) and high (160 watts) temperature settings. The mean times for the coldest areas in Cooker B (removable liner) to reach 50 C were 2.35 and 0.52 h for the low (130 watts) and high (260 watts) temperature settings, respectively. Results suggest that when the recommended quantities of ingredients are used and the proper cooking procedure followed, foods prepared in the slow cookers studied do not present a health hazard.

In the Newsletter of January 1, 1968, the American Academy of Pediatrics reported that the executive board strongly endorsed time American Cancer Society's anti-smoking resolution. Personally, I cannot agree with the approach of the resolution to the public health hazard of smoking. If the American Academy of Pediatrics (or for that matter, the American Cancer Society) wanted to back effective measures, an entirely different type of resolution would have been adopted, one that would have put the emphasis On reaciling the younger generation.
